> I tried your files and got the same result except I could open the
> pictures in firefox-1.5.0.5.
> Oddly, the first render looked ok and the others were speckled even
> without the rotate.
> 
> When I changed the planes to 
> 
> plane
> {
>    <1, 0, 0>, 0.01
>    rotate <0, -72, 0>
> }
> plane
> {
>    <1, 0, 0>, 0.01
>    rotate <0, 90, 0>
> }
> 
> the problem went away.
